Now
skiers, snowboarders and mountaineers have realized the
potential of using kites to cross long distances and reach
new heights in record time. The backcountry scene is rapidly
growing. The most aggressive snowkiters are slowly being
drawn to the flying aspect. They use the kites to climb
the mountain, turn around and then peel away from the face
of the slope, sometimes reaching heights of 150 feet with
flights exceeding 90 seconds.
Learning to snow kite is fun, easy and very accessible.
No more lift tickets or lift lines. Just throw on a snowboard
or skis, grab your kite and find a frozen lake or field
with snow, and you will soon be cutting your way through
powder trails.
